Salted Caramel Chocolate Chip Cookie Bars
This recipe from deesviral layers buttery cookie dough with gooey caramel and melty chocolate chips, all finished with a sprinkle of flaky sea salt. The result? A chewy, golden bar that’s as irresistible as it sounds.
Ingredients
Cookie Dough:
1 cup unsalted butter
1 cup granulated sugar
1 cup light brown sugar, packed
2 large eggs
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 ½ cups all-purpose flour
½ teaspoon sea salt
1 teaspoon baking soda
2 cups semi-sweet chocolate chips
Caramel Mixture:
11 oz soft caramels, unwrapped
14 oz sweetened condensed milk
½ teaspoon sea salt flakes (such as Maldon)
Preparation Steps
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Prepare a 9×13-inch baking pan with parchment paper.
Cream butter with both sugars until smooth. Beat in eggs and vanilla.
In a separate bowl, whisk flour, baking soda, and sea salt. Add gradually into wet mixture until combined.
Stir in chocolate chips, then chill the dough.
Melt caramels with condensed milk in a saucepan over medium-low heat, stirring until smooth. Add flaky salt.
Press half the cookie dough into the baking pan. Pour caramel mixture evenly over the base. Scatter remaining dough in pieces on top.
Bake for 25 minutes until golden brown. Sprinkle extra sea salt for garnish. Allow bars to cool fully before slicing.
Serving Information
Prep Time: 20 minutes
Bake Time: 25 minutes
Total Time: 45 minutes
Servings: About 24 bars
